What is the difference between smart positioner and normal positioner. Please add some additional info regarding IO count for both the positioners. Do they possess both AI and AO or just AI ?
Smart positioners are simply based on latest digital electronics, onboard CPU etc. They are capable of communicating through digital network such as HART, Fieldbus, Profibus etc. They are able to provide many critical diagnostic data locally and also through the digital communication network. Normal positioner e.g. traditional electronic positioners are based on analog electronics and they can't provide many critical diagnostic data or can't be connected to a digital network. Both of them could be connected over AO signal from the DCS. Smart positioner could be connected over analog or digital network and could provide many useful advanced features. For example you can connect a smart positioner over a 4-20 mA loop, but can collect the real time valve position feedback over the same loop using HART protocol. You don't have to buy another valve position feedback transmitter for this.
A normal positioner is an electropneumatic device that controls the position of a valve actuator based on a 4–20 mA analog signal from the controller.
It compares the input signal (representing the desired position) to the actual valve position and adjusts the actuator pressure accordingly.
A smart positioner is a microprocessor-based device that also receives a 4–20 mA signal.
